Amaravati, Nov 5 (NationPress) Andhra Pradesh's Minister for Human Resources Development, Information Technology, and Electronics, Nara Lokesh, has extended his congratulations to Zohran Mamdani for being elected as the Mayor of New York City.

Lokesh, who is the son of Chief Minister N. Chandrababu Naidu, praised Mamdani's campaign as a masterclass in modern politics.

The General Secretary of the Telugu Desam Party (TDP) shared his commendations on X, celebrating Mamdani's victory in the New York City mayoral election.

"As a young politician of Indian heritage, his campaign has been a masterclass in modern politics—characterized by sharp messaging, savvy social media engagement, and genuine connections with the public. Politics is constantly evolving, and we must adapt too. There are valuable lessons for aspiring politicians worldwide," Lokesh expressed.

Mamdani, a Democratic socialist, won the mayoral seat, triumphing over former New York governor Andrew Cuomo. At just 34 years old, he is the first Muslim and the first individual of Indian descent to occupy this prestigious position.

Born on October 18, 1991, in Kampala, Uganda, Mamdani is the son of renowned Ugandan scholar Mahmood Mamdani and celebrated Indian filmmaker Mira Nair.

His formative years included a journey from Uganda to South Africa before settling in New York City, where he attended both the Bank Street School for Children and Bronx High School of Science.

He earned his degree in Africana Studies from Bowdoin College in 2014, co-founding a chapter of Students for Justice in Palestine during his time there.

In his victory address, Mamdani quoted Jawaharlal Nehru, India's inaugural Prime Minister, affirming that his win signifies a transition from the old to the new.

Additionally, he noted that his achievement dismantled a longstanding political dynasty.

"As I stand before you, I reflect on the words of Jawaharlal Nehru—a rare moment in history arises when we transition from the old to the new, when an age concludes, and when a suppressed nation's spirit finds expression. This evening, we have indeed moved from the old into the new," he proclaimed during his victory speech.
